My dishes for the last 10 years have been Mikasa. They are well-made and sturdy, while also being delicate. While they're mostly sold in big box department stores, I've been really happy with my dishes and would buy more in the future.

I use a set of flatware made by Mikasa on a regular basis and have no complaints. I think the flatware is great quality and I love the thicker handles on my set. So many flatware sets have such thin handles that they bend easily if you are eating or scooping something a little firmer (ice cream and spoons for example).
